Message AFAIK...

An oil ring doesn't "seat" in the same way a compression ring does. First, what kind of oil did you use for break in? Have you changed it yet? When you first started driving it, was it stop and go stuff?

Next thing to consider, are the PCV valves new? It is pretty amazing how much oil collects in the plenum over time because of the way the Z PCV system is designed. Until the rings get seated well, you will have a little more blow by than you otherwise would, and it is possible that you are seeing the result of that.

If you haven't changed your oil yet, do so, and I am probably not telling you anything you don't already know, but use a straight dino oil, no synthetic or syn blends.
